I just got these from Kingsmenquilts and I really like them. I'm using them on a quilt now. What I like about them is that I can use either a concave side or convex side. The blocks I'm using them on now are diamonds which have different size sides but I can make them look pretty consistant. The price is good too. I'm waiting for the 2" and 5" which are on BO.
